That "healthy" CRM pipeline you've built? For most B2B SaaS companies, it's stuffed with contacts who will never, ever buy from you.
They downloaded a whitepaper in 2022. They attended a webinar under their old job title. They booked a demo, ghosted you, and you haven't touched them since. They're not leads. They're overhead.

Here are three questions every SaaS leadership team should be asking — and almost none are:
1. What percentage of your CRM entries are genuinely in-market right now?
Not "active" because they opened an email. Actually in a buying cycle, with budget, authority, and a genuine need.
2. How much is lead-generation theatre costing you?
Volume targets that force your team to capture every click. Nurture sequences fired at contacts who left the industry. Paid campaigns optimised for cost-per-click, not cost-per-qualified-opportunity. The CRM platform licence alone doesn't lie — you're paying to store ghosts.
3. When did Sales and Marketing last agree on what a qualified lead actually looks like?
If this conversation hasn't happened recently — or was never really resolved — your pipeline is a polite fiction that keeps both teams busy without driving revenue.
The fix isn't more leads. It's fewer, better ones. It's a shared ICP definition, a lead-scoring model that reflects real buying signals, and the courage to archive the dead weight.
